Commentary


L’officine 0 est l’une de celles qui frappent pour Julia Domna mais dont le gros de la production sera consacré à Macrin.
On notera que le portrait de l’impératrice reprend la coiffure à lourdes mèche et le petit diadème mais ne pose pas le buste sur un croissant de lune.
L’attribution des séries au Shamash à Emesa est plus que probable mais la découverte d’une émission de présentation qui viendrait le confirmer serait la bienvenue.
Les émissions sont réparties en officines, terme impropre car il ne s’agit certainement pas d’officines au sens d’une répartition de la production. En effet, certaines lettres ou symboles se retrouvent sur de très nombreux exemplaires, d’autres sur une poignée : on doit donc plutôt réfléchir en source de financement, réparti probablement entre différentes familles ou institutions locales.
On note que les sigma sont gravés en C.
Dans la base TSP maintenue par Michel Prieur, quatorze exemplaires sont maintenant répertoriés, quatre en musées, à Paris, Fonds Général, à l’American Numismatic Society, ex Newell, à Oxford et à Berne, ex Righetti. Notre exemplaire, qui provient de la trouvaille dite de Turquie 1930, est le 0995_005.
Office 0 is one of those that strikes Julia Domna but whose bulk of production will be devoted to Macrinus.
It should be noted that the portrait of the Empress uses the hairstyle with heavy locks and the small diadem but does not place the bust on a crescent moon..
The attribution of the series to Shamash in Emesa is more than likely, but the discovery of a presentation program that would confirm this would be welcome..
The emissions are distributed into pharmacies, an improper term because these are certainly not pharmacies in the sense of a distribution of production.. Indeed, some letters or symbols are found on a large number of examples, others on a handful: we should therefore rather think about the source of funding, probably distributed between different families or local institutions..
Note that the sigmas are engraved in C.
In the TSP database maintained by Michel Prieur, fourteen examples are now listed, four in museums, in Paris, Fonds Général, at the American Numismatic Society, ex Newell, in Oxford and in Berne, ex Righetti. Our example, which comes from the so-called Turkey 1930 find, is 0995_005

Historical background


JULIA DOMNA

(+217)

Augusta

Julia Domna is from Emesa in Syria and daughter of the High Priest of Baal of Emesa. Septimius Severus married her around 180. She gave him two sons, Caracalla, born in Lyon in 188, and Géta, born in 189. She was proclaimed Augusta in 194, accompanied the Emperor on his travels and therefore received the title of " Mother of the camps". During the Brittany expedition, she was regent in Rome. After the death of Septimius Severus, she received new honors, Mother of the Senate and Mother of the Country, as well as the titles of Pia Felix (pious and happy). In 212, Geta was assassinated by his brother in the arms of Domna. During Caracalla's Germanic and Parthian expeditions, Domna remained in Rome. After the death of her son, she is exiled by Macrinus and dies soon after..
